Episode 103, Learn the "How" to program yourself for success!
Did you ever wonder why some people are more successful than others? Sales leaders who always find a way to reach and exceed their revenue goals. An entrepreneur who started from nothing and is now a Billionaire. How about an athlete that performs at a higher level than others. The person on the path for better health and wellness.
What is the one word that stops most people from succeeding? How!
Think about your health and wellness on how to lose weight, for example. There are thousands of programs to help you lose weight or improve your overall health. The WW -Weight Watchers, Noom, Nutrisystem, Jenny Craig, or you follow the Mediterranean diet, Plant-based or low carb program. The statistics are that 1 in 3 Americans are overweight. How can that be with all " How to" programs available to us.
Let's take a look at our business. Technology has transformed how we do business. The internet has all the answers to your questions; ask google! Today, we can find others who have already created the roadmap to success.
In sales, the How to is available to all of us.
How to prospect and find the perfect client.
How to start a conversation and set the first meeting.
How to write the perfect proposal and get your client to say yes.
How to build trust and have a client for life.
I was programmed by other leaders during my career the following phrase" "Knowledge is Power." I do agree that Knowledge is Power - the How. The truth is, " Knowledge is potential power. Power is the action and execution!
If you want to succeed, you have to avoid the Tyranny of How!
If you want to succeed, you start with What you want and WHY you want it! Then you will find the HOW to achieve! The sequence of these three words will determine your success. What, Why, and then How!
When you have strong enough reasons for something, you will figure out how to get it.

My recommendation is to ask yourself the following questions:
- What do you want to create, improve or achieve? What is your intention and vision for yourself? It would be best if you were very specific. If you want better health or lose weight, say I must lose 10lbs versus the phrase I need to lose weight. If you're going to make more money, state the exact number. I need to make $300,000 a year. See, when you get clear on the goal you want to achieve, your brain gets excited and will search for the answer, the How!
- Why is it vital for you to achieve it! Your heart, not your head. You are your possibilities, not your circumstances. Using the example of better health, so I have the freedom to do the things I love in life! I have the energy to travel, play with my kids, and connect and share my life with others. If you need to make the $300,000, Why? So you have the financial freedom to live life on your terms? Is it to put your kids in private schools? Buy the car of your dreams? Build the house of your dreams? To make an impact helping others like a pet shelter or help the homeless. It's WHY is it a must, not a should. I must do this, not should or could. How would you celebrate helping others, and what feeling would you experience. The Why is the emotional reason you experience!
- What needs to change? What needs to shift or change now for you to get what you want? What old pattern needs to become a new pathway for you? This is the How!
